monserrat castellani wasn't your typical modern gay boy. living in a well sized studio apartment in new york; he is the epitome of art. a painter, a fashion enthusiast and designer; who is very intelligent, but nonetheless, a boy who ignores his feelings much more than he should. monserrat is poised, and knows what he wants in life. to design clothes, and live in peace. but, to his disappointment, things don't always work out as planned. when his (ex) boyfriend amadeus shows up on his doorstep, drunk, slightly beat up and emotional, he is faced with more issues than he could imagine. this is a novel about finding yourself, forgiveness, acceptance, and love. this is not your typical gay love story. this is the story of the painter and the pianist. of monserrat and amadeus. cover by the lovely @aeris-

When a historian's obsession with a nineteenth century diary drives him to investigate the mysterious 'Fire King,' the truth turns his life upside down ... and leads him to fall for the one person he knows he can't have. ***** After Ryan McCoy's best friend shows him a two-hundred-year-old diary that was found in her house during a refurbishment, he becomes preoccupied with its contents. His love of history ignites his curiosity about a series of suspicious and implausible events described in the aged manuscript, including a possible homophobic arson attack on a local property. But how much is fact and how much is fiction? Can he unravel the secrets of the book and uncover the truth that has been locked between its pages for two hundred years? Author's Note: I am aware that the language spoken in Ireland two hundred years ago has variations to that spoken in modern times. However, I'm also aware that Wattpad is culturally diverse, and for many readers, English is not their first language. Many people may not be familiar with archaic Irish dialect, which may detract from the enjoyment of the story. Therefore, in an effort to make this story comprehensible to everyone, I have prioritised reader accessibility over historical accuracy with regard to any language that might otherwise be seen as dated. Trigger Warning: This book contains details of a homophobic arson attack. It also contains details of the aftermath of such an event, including the exploration of themes such as PTSD and trauma responses. Those who are sensitive to these topics may like to be aware of this content before reading.
